: Admissions of Covid-19 patients to health facilities per 100,000 population dropped 8.6 per cent in the third epidemiological week 2023 from Jan 15 to 21 compared to the previous week, said Health director-general Tan Sri Dr Noor Hisham Abdullah.
“The utilisation rates of non-critical and ICU beds decreased by two per cent respectively in ME 3/2023 compared to the previous week,” he said in a statement today. According to him, Malaysia’s cumulative Covid-19 infections from Jan 25, 2020, to Jan 21, 2023, stood at 5,034,521, while cumulative recoveries were 4,987,642 cases.
Dr Noor Hisham said the total number of recovered cases in ME 3/2023 dropped by 27.6 per cent , while the number of new infections decreased by 17.3 per cent from the previous week.
